Aim to place your treadmill in an open area with plenty of ceiling height. Good options include a basement, spare bedroom, or home office. For your comfort and safety, allow for 1.83 metres of clear space behind the machine and 0.61 metres on either side. The front of the treadmill will also need 0.61 metres of space for ventilation. Bear in mind that a ceiling height of around 2.44 metres should provide ample clearance for most treadmills.
Treadmills can be a bit noisy, which might annoy your family or the neighbours. You can reduce treadmill noise with a dedicated mat, by placing it in a good spot, and with regular upkeep. A treadmill noise reduction mat can soak up the sound and impact of a treadmill. If you can, try to avoid putting the treadmill right next to walls, as they can amplify or echo the sounds. Lubricating the belt and other routine maintenance will also help keep the noise down.
You won’t typically need to supply tools for your treadmill assembly service. Most treadmills come with the necessary wrenches for various nuts and bolt sizes. Otherwise, Taskers may bring extra tools like a Phillips screwdriver or an adjustable wrench. It’s always a good idea to let your Tasker know in advance if they’ll need to bring their own tools along.
The time it takes to assemble a treadmill depends on the model and the person doing the assembly. Experienced Taskers can typically put together a treadmill in about one to two hours. However, assembly might take longer if you’re tackling it alone or if you’re not entirely sure how to go about it. Assembling a treadmill often requires an extra pair of hands.
